(1)     no taxes imposed by the Estate Tax Act N.M. Stat. Ann. § 7-7-1 to 7-7-12 are due; or

(2)     the taxes due under the Estate Tax Act have been paid.

B. If the estate is not required to file a federal estate tax return, the filing of a certificate by the department is not required.

C. No court shall allow the final settlement of the account of any personal representative until either a certificate is filed as provided in this section if the estate is required to file a federal estate tax return or the personal representative demonstrates that the estate was not required to file a federal estate tax return.
